The United States laser eyewear market is experiencing steady growth driven by increased awareness about eye safety, particularly in industrial and medical settings where laser technology is widely used. The market is characterized by a wide range of products including laser safety glasses, goggles, and face shields designed to protect the eyes from harmful laser radiation. Key players in the market offer innovative products with advanced features such as adjustable frames, anti-fog coatings, and enhanced visibility. The market is also influenced by stringent safety regulations and standards set by organizations such as the American National Standards Institute (ANSI) and the Occupational Safety and Health Administration (OSHA). With the rising adoption of laser technology across various industries, the demand for laser eyewear is expected to continue growing in the US market.

In the United States, the Laser Eyewear Market is subject to various government regulations and policies to ensure product safety and efficacy. The Food and Drug Administration (FDA) oversees the regulation of laser eyewear to protect consumers from potential harm caused by laser exposure. Manufacturers are required to comply with FDA guidelines for the design, labeling, and performance of laser eyewear to meet safety standards. Additionally, the Occupational Safety and Health Administration (OSHA) mandates the use of protective eyewear in workplaces where employees may be exposed to laser radiation. These regulations aim to promote the safe use of laser eyewear in both consumer and industrial settings, emphasizing the importance of quality control and risk mitigation in the market.
